Today we discuss how the Germans are dealing with the current crisis. Germans are known to respect clear rules and guidelines, but are they really always obedient? How about the developing work culture? Will there be benefits and a softer, more mellow culture in corporate Germany? And we talk about May the 1st - Union Day.
